使用时需遵守规则:只能委托同类构造函数、初始化列表中唯一调用、不可多次委托或形成循环。
对于初入Go语言的开发者而言,理解如何正确地组织和导入本地代码库(即Go中的“包”)是一个常见的挑战。
来画数字人直播 来画数字人自动化直播,无需请真人主播,即可实现24小时直播,无缝衔接各大直播平台。
解决方法包括提取公共接口到独立包、重构职责、依赖注入和延迟初始化,核心是打破双向依赖,保持单向清晰的依赖层次。
如果随机延迟的差异不足以打破这种初始的“平衡”,我们就会持续看到交替的输出。
对所管理对象的线程安全需自行保证 即使多个线程各自持有一个指向同一对象的shared_ptr副本,对这个对象的读写仍需同步。
我们将国家对应的颜色字符串作为自定义数据属性data-colors存储在这里。
如果你将bufio.Reader和bufio.Writer作为io.Copy的源和目标,那么整个拷贝过程将是高度优化的,兼顾了底层IO效率和内存缓冲。
在实际项目中,几乎都会涉及数据库操作。
多模块结构虽增加了配置复杂度,但提升了项目的可维护性和扩展性。
如果 comment_id 包含一个有效的 article_comments 表的 id,则表示这条评论是对该 id 评论的回复。
随机位置 2 (原始索引 4): ID: 5, 内容: Go的垃圾回收机制是如何工作的?
make_sound 方法的执行顺序: 当 my_dog.make_sound() 被调用时,首先执行 Dog 类 make_sound 方法中的第一行 print 语句("Dog says: Bark!")。
比如,如果一个字段只接受数字,那就严格限制它只能是数字。
这类插件通常提供拖放式编辑器、丰富的模板和动态标签,极大地简化了邮件设计过程。
这通常是由于f.read()方法在读取文件时,会将文件末尾的换行符(\n)也一并读取到字符串中。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
使用 time.h 获取时间(C风格) 最简单的方式是使用<ctime>头文件中的time()函数来获取当前时间的秒数,再通过localtime()转换为本地时间结构。
在构建交互式数据仪表板时,动态更新数据是常见的需求。
D语言: D语言的设计哲学与C/C++有相似之处,其浮点类型通常也遵循IEEE 754标准: float: 32位单精度浮点数。
本文链接:http://www.altodescuento.com/279416_3018e4.html